Shipping Estimates for Thai Campers
Before you hit the checkout button, it is essential to understand the logistics of moving a sturdy cooler halfway across the world. Using an international shipping service is the most efficient way to get your gear home, but you should be prepared for the following physical specs:
- Box Weight: Approximately 11 lbs (5 kg) when packed with protective materials.
- Box Dimensions: Expect a medium-sized parcel roughly 18" x 13" x 16".
- Volumetric Warning: Since coolers are essentially insulated boxes filled with air, they are prone to volumetric weight charges. This means the shipping cost might be calculated based on the size of the box rather than its actual weight. Always use a shipping calculator to get a precise quote before finalizing your purchase.
- Battery Check: The Yeti Roadie 15 does not contain any lithium batteries or electronic components, making it a very 'clean' item for international shipping rates without extra hazardous material surcharges.

Avoiding the heat with Thai import rules
When your cooler arrives at Suvarnabhumi or Don Mueang, it will be subject to local regulations. Understanding the import tax structure in Thailand is vital for a smooth Thailand delivery. Typically, outdoor equipment is subject to a standard duty rate plus a 7% VAT.
